This Request for Information (RFI) for Air Traffic Controller (ATC) training is being issued in accordance with the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) Acquisition Management System (AMS) Policy 3.2.1.2.1. Responses to this RFI will be used for informational purposes only to support the development of a contracting strategy for ATC training. The information will not be released except as required under the Freedom of Information Act (FOIA). Proprietary information will be protected if appropriately marked. This is not a Screening Information Request or Request for Proposal. The purpose of this announcement is to obtain industry feedback on an updated acquisition strategy as well as the application of innovative training technologies and models for the next generation of ATC Training Support Services program. Historically, these complex training services�encompassing institutional classroom instruction, simulation laboratory support, and curriculum maintenance and development at the FAA Academy and field facilities�have been procured using a Time & Materials (T&M) contract structure for everything other than Program Management activities. Currently, the contract supports two primary locations for instruction: FAA Academy (~40% of value under T&M): Centralized foundational training and workforce development. Field Facilities (~60% of value under T&M): Localized delivery across 300+ nationwide sites (EnRoute centers, TRACONs, and airport control towers). Executive Order 14402 �Promoting Efficiency, Accountability, and Performance in Federal Contracting,� directs Federal agencies to prioritize fixed-price (FP) contracts with performance-based considerations to improve efficiency, accountability, and cost control in government procurement. In alignment with this policy, the FAA intends to transition to a firm-fixed-price (FFP) contract structure for its ATC training support requirements. The FAA seeks specific industry feedback on how to best structure a future ATC training contract as a FFP vehicle to ensure the continued delivery of world-class training while mitigating cost overruns and performance risks. Additionally, the FAA requests industry feedback on designing a FFP structure that incentivizes contractors throughout the period of performance to continuously identify, evaluate, and integrate innovative methods, technologies, tools, and curricula (such as but not limited to advanced simulation, AI-driven adaptive learning, or updated instruction techniques) without requiring costly or complex contract modifications.
